Babes-Ernst granules are characteristic of which organism?

Explanation:
Babes-Ernst granules are distinctive intracellular inclusions that are characteristic of Corynebacterium diphtheriae, the bacterium responsible for diphtheria. These granules are composed of a polymer of polyphosphate, and their presence is crucial for the identification of this specific organism. Under a microscope, they appear as metachromatic granules, which can be visualized using certain staining techniques, such as Albert's stain. Corynebacterium diphtheriae exhibits a unique morphology, often described as "Chinese letters," due to its club-shaped cells. Identifying Babes-Ernst granules aids in confirming the diagnosis of infections caused by this pathogen, which is essential because diphtheria can lead to severe respiratory complications and has a significant impact if not treated timely.
